Town Manager T. Marsh told the Selectboard the town has roughly $600,000 in uncollected taxes and $600,000 in uncollected water and sewer utilities and warned finances will be tight in June with a $1,000,000 school payment due before the end of the month.

Town Manager T. Marsh provided the Selectboard with a third-quarter financial update, saying the town currently has approximately $600,000 in uncollected property taxes and approximately $600,000 in uncollected water and sewer utility bills. Marsh cautioned that the town will face tight cash flow in June when a $1,000,000 payment to the school system is due before the end of the month.

Marsh said staff member N. Culma has been working with M. Williams in the Fire Department to better understand billing and scheduling processes. No board action was taken; the report was informational and followed by other agenda items including upcoming Dump Day scheduling on June 13, 2026.
